I have given training to educators on the use of Canva. I have also used Canva in my classroom and in classrooms with other teachers. I have seen Canva used in many ways in the classroom. Some teachers have used it as a one-pager assignment, some teachers have used it as a timeline project, some teachers have used it as a platform to make invitations, and some teachers have used it as a presentation tool to present information. Another teacher used to make informational brochures based on the unit they just studied.
